Central Ohio boasts numerous prominent brands, yet small businesses often make a significant impact. A thoughtful viewer inquired about Columbus's oldest family-run enterprise. This led us to E.E. Ward Moving & Storage, founded in 1881, recognized as the oldest continuously operating Black-owned business in America. John T. Ward, a conductor on the Underground Railroad, laid the foundation for resilience and commitment. The company evolved from horse-drawn wagons to modern logistics, expanding beyond Columbus while maintaining core values. Its philanthropic heritage, championed by Eldon Ward, remains strong, embodying the spirit of service and community dedication.
